By Product Type
Moldboard Plows:
Moldboard plows are a staple in traditional agriculture, designed to effectively turn the soil in preparation for planting. These plows are ideal for breaking up compacted soil, enabling better aeration and penetration of water and nutrients. The demand for moldboard plows is significant in regions with diverse soil types, as they are versatile and can be adjusted for various soil conditions. Their ability to incorporate crop residues into the soil enhances organic matter content, thereby improving soil health. As farmers increasingly recognize the benefits of soil conservation and fertility enhancement, the moldboard plow continues to be a popular choice across various agricultural sectors, driving its market growth.
Disc Plows:
Disc plows are gaining traction due to their efficiency in tackling tougher soil conditions. The circular discs cut and turn the soil, making them particularly effective in rocky or hard soils that would typically resist moldboard plowing. This type of plow is characterized by its ability to maintain a consistent depth, which is crucial for uniform crop growth. Farmers favor disc plows for their durability and ability to operate in various terrains, leading to a growing adoption in both conventional and conservation tillage practices. The rising interest in conservation agriculture is also boosting the use of disc plows, as they are well-suited for minimizing soil disturbance while promoting soil health.
Chisel Plows:
Chisel plows are specifically designed for deep tillage without inverting the soil, making them less disruptive to soil structure and beneficial for preserving soil moisture. They are particularly favored in no-till and reduced-till systems, which are gaining popularity as sustainable farming practices. The demand for chisel plows is expected to rise due to the increasing adoption of these conservation techniques to combat soil erosion and degradation. Farmers appreciate that chisel plows allow for the incorporation of organic matter and crop residues into the soil while maintaining worms and microbial activity, thus enhancing overall soil health. This growing trend among environmentally conscious farmers is driving market growth for chisel plows.
Subsoil Plows:
Subsoil plows are tailored for deep soil penetration, breaking up compacted layers below the surface. This type of plow is a vital tool for improving root growth and enhancing water infiltration, making it essential for farmers dealing with heavy clay or compacted soils. The growing awareness about soil health and crop productivity is propelling the use of subsoil plows, particularly in regions where soil compaction is a significant issue. Farmers are increasingly investing in subsoil plowing to optimize their land's performance, leading to improved yields and sustainable agricultural practices. As a result, the demand for subsoil plows is expected to see a steady increase over the coming years.
Rotary Plows:
Rotary plows are revolutionizing the plowing market with their ability to work through a variety of soil types and conditions efficiently. These plows utilize rotating blades to cut and mix the soil, making them ideal for preparing seedbeds. The demand for rotary plows has surged with the increasing trend towards precision agriculture, where farmers seek tools that can offer more control over their tillage practices. Additionally, rotary plows are favored for their reduced labor requirements and improved operational speed, allowing farmers to cover more ground in less time. This efficiency is particularly appealing to large-scale operations, driving the growth of the rotary plow segment in the market.

By Material Type
Steel:
Steel is the most commonly used material in the manufacturing of plowing equipment due to its durability and strength. Plows made from steel are capable of withstanding the rigors of demanding agricultural tasks, making them a preferred choice for farmers dealing with tough soil conditions. Additionally, steel's resistance to wear and tear ensures a longer lifespan, providing excellent value for money. Many manufacturers are also incorporating alloyed steel into their designs to enhance performance characteristics, such as improved corrosion resistance and weight reduction. The unwavering demand for steel plows is expected to drive growth in this material segment, particularly as farmers seek reliable and long-lasting options.
Iron:
Iron plows, particularly cast iron, have a historical significance in farming. While less common than steel, they are still utilized for specific applications and are known for their robustness. Iron plows can provide excellent performance in certain soil types, especially in less rocky terrain. The traditional appeal of iron for some farmers stems from its ability to effectively till soil while maintaining a classic craftsmanship feel. However, the market for iron plows is gradually being overtaken by more advanced materials, yet they still hold unique niche applications in the plows market, particularly among enthusiasts and traditional farming practices.
Aluminum:
Aluminum is emerging as a lightweight alternative in the plowing equipment market, offering enhanced maneuverability and ease of use. The primary advantage of aluminum plows is their corrosion resistance, which is beneficial in environments where soil moisture can lead to rust and deterioration of equipment. As environmental considerations become more prominent, aluminumÔÇÖs recyclability and lower energy consumption during production are gaining traction among eco-conscious farmers. However, aluminum plows are less prevalent in heavy-duty applications due to their reduced strength compared to steel, but they are finding a place in specific applications where weight and resistance to degradation are prioritized.
Composite:
Composite materials, often comprising a blend of different materials, are increasingly finding their way into the plows market. These materials can provide significant advantages, such as enhanced strength-to-weight ratios and improved durability against wear. Composite plows can be designed to optimize performance in various soil conditions while maintaining lower overall weight, facilitating easier handling and operation. The growing interest in innovative materials among manufacturers is likely to drive the development of composite plows, particularly as the demand for lightweight and efficient farming equipment increases. This segment is expected to see gradual growth as research and development continue to focus on enhancing composite materials for agriculture applications.
